Ryan O’Neal stars a small time drifter in this 1974 gem from Peter Bogdanovich. When he is guilted into transporting a recently-orphaned girl who may or may not be his child (played be real life daughter Tatum O’Neal) he finds himself begrudgingly taken by her charm. But wait, by “charm” I don’t mean that she’s cute or precious. No, she cusses, smokes and (it turns out) is a better “con-man” than he ever dreamed of being.
It was shot in black and white (a bold choice for a studio picture) and that, combined with its use of ambient sound rather than a traditional score, helps the film capture its Depression Era feel. The film manages to be charming, funny, heart-wrenching and touching without ever becoming maudlin or overly sentimental.
